Product Description

General
The Chrosziel CDM-FLEX-FIZ Servo Drive Unit was developed exclusively for all the lens derivates of the CANON Flex (CNE-xx-xxx) Series and is field installable. This compact and ergonomic design allows you to integrate the all-manual “cine-style” CANON Flex Zoom lens into your broadcast, multi- camera, or remote head workflows in a straightforward way. As on typical TV style broadcast lenses, all motors and connectors are brought together in one housing with common interface connections like demand sockets, a lens port interface, and a remote-control socket.
Three perfectly positioned drive gears engage the CANON Flex Lens with a high degree of precision employing three powerful digital motors. The Chrosziel CDM-FLEX-FIZ is particularly useful for cinematic Multi Camera, ENG and OB work where zoom and focus can be controlled from standard TV style tripod demands or the onboard zoom rocker. It supports remote head and robotics applications via the Hirose 20pin remote interface including encoder outputs for focus and zoom motor. It allows to directly control the drive’s focus, zoom and iris by the Chrosziel Magnum wireless FIZ hand unit via radio and all other compatible FIZ- systems via a wired connection.

Product Safety, Operating voltage, and temperature
Short circuit protection is performed by a protective fuse which insulates the device from the power supply in case of over-current events caused by unexpected internal failures. In addition, power input is polarity-protected. The nominal input voltage of the CANON Flex Servo Drives is 10–30V. At temperatures below -10° Celsius or above 50° Celsius, optimum functioning of the product can no longer be guaranteed. A constant operating temperature of approx. 20° Celsius is recommended. The device can be used in moderate outdoor conditions.

Preparation

Chrosziel-CDM-FLEX-FIZ-Canon-Flex-Servo-Drive-FIG-1Mounting the drive to the lens

  1. Follow these steps to mount the CANON Flex Servo Drive to the CANON Flex lens:
  2. Remove /the i-data port holder (4 pins 00 sizes LEMO) from the lens, take care not to drop/lose the screws.
  3. Make sure the threads are clean and free from damage.
  4. Mount the CANON Flex Servo Drive onto the lens. Take care, that the Position Adjusting Pin (see Figure 1) will move smoothly into the whole above the I-Data contacts on the lens. The three gears from the CANON Flex Servo Drive must interlock with the respective gears of the lens. The bar of the /i-data port must fit perfectly to the corresponding notch of the lens.
  5. With the additional included 2,5 mm Allen Key, screw the lower spring-loaded mounting screw (see Figure 1) in the lower thread of the lens. Do the same with the upper spring-loaded mounting screw. Do not fully tighten the lower screw until the upper one is screwed in. Finally, fix both screws carefully not overturning the threads. Ensure that all gears are attached to the standard 0.8mm pitch gears of the lens.
  6. Fix both M2 anti-loss screws (see Figure 1) carefully.
  7. Rotate the lens gears (F/I/Z rings) by hand. The gears should move freely without blocking from one to the other hard end stop.
  8. Mount the antenna to the CANON Flex Servo drive (see Figure 3) if the Magnum hand unit shall be used for wireless operation and select a radio channel from “5” to F, otherwise set the code wheel to “4” or less.
  9. The drive is now installed, and the lens can be used as an ENG-style broadcast lens.

Installing and using the CANON Flex Zoom Lens as a broadcast lens

Once the drive is installed the lens can be mounted to any PL/EF-mount camera. As the drive features all the typical connectors of a broadcast lens, it will integrate flawlessly into the broadcast workflow.
After installing the lens to the camera, connect the Zoom and Focus demands as well as the Lensport cable to the camera’s body. Power the drive via the power cable (MN-AB-A) from a stronger 12-15V power source (i.e., from the D-tap outlet of a battery). Alternatively, power the drive from the RS 3pin Fischer socket on the camera if available. The needed cable for this is RS-A2-P/CAM. Right after the drive is powered it will calibrate the lens end stops for every axis at the same time as there are Focus, Iris, and Zoom.

Note : lens is calibrated after each power cycle.

Auto calibration in detail
The calibration of the CANON Flex Servo Drive is an essential part of the setup to guarantee precise, reliable operation of the device. Calibration is a procedure where the precise torque resistance and the mechanical hard end stops of the lens is recorded for every axis. The procedure ensures optimal reliability in use. Please ensure there are no obstructions between the gears of the lenses and the CANON Flex Servo Drive. Do not touch the ring of the lenses during calibration as this will cause false torque resistance readings.
As soon as the CANON Flex Servo Drive is connected to the power source the auto calibration starts. While the yellow status LEDs near the Zoom/Focus/Iris buttons blink, auto-calibration is in progress and the device identifies the end stops of the lenses. Do not touch any moving parts during auto- calibration. Calibration is complete when both ends stops on every axis have been identified and the LEDs are either OFF or static ON. The CANON Flex Servo Drive is now ready to shoot.

Operation

Controls and signaling LEDs

Chrosziel-CDM-FLEX-FIZ-Canon-Flex-Servo-Drive-FIG-2

Band of five blue LEDs
displays sensitivity levels 1-5 of the onboard Zoom rocker. If no LED is lit (sensitivity = 0), the On-Board Zoom Rocker is disabled. The selected setting is stored in nonvolatile memory and restored after the next power cycle.

Control buttons for F/I/Z motor drives

Functions are

  • Single operation toggles between motor activated and deactivated (freely to move by hand or external motor)
  • Continuous operation for more than 3 seconds starts the automatic lens calibration for the related axis

Status LEDs for F/I/Z motor driver

RET Button/VTR-Button
implement the related functionality for external RETURN & VTR video switching as on typical broadcast lenses in multi-camera set-ups.

Code wheel for radio channel
Select the radio channel for communicating with an external Magnum hand unit. Only the channels “5”-F can be used. Channel numbers lower than “5″ will switch off the radio module. When the green Channel LED is on, the connection between the Hand unit and the CANON Flex Servo Drive is established.

On-Board Zoom Rocker
For changing the direction of the Zoomer Rocker:

  1. Turn off the power.
  2. press and hold the “+ Sensibility” button.
  3. turn on the power and wait a second.
  4. release the “+ Sensibility” button.
  5. The On-Board Zoom Rocker changes operational direction. All external Zoom demands are not affected!

Connectors: For pin-outs refer to section 11.1 “Connector pin assignment” below.

Chrosziel-CDM-FLEX-FIZ-Canon-Flex-Servo-Drive-FIG-5

Power-In 5pin Lemo 0B size:
Due to the stiffness of gears on a CANON Flex Cine Zoom, the needed power is higher than on other typical TV- Lens Servo drives. Make sure to use a strong power supply like 13.5V / 4A (~50 Watts).

  • Native Lens port interface 12pin Hirose
    TV- Lens port compatible interface (analog & digital) for applications with i.e., Sony Venice or ARRI LCUBE

  • Native CANON Focus/ Zoom Demand Interface (analog):
    Both sockets implement the original CANON Demand Socket base functionality. Take care to connect the demands (Focus Wheel and Zoom Rocker) to the corresponding 20-pin demand socket.

  • Native CANON Remote Port 20pin Hirose:
    In addition to one digital interface (CANON digital demand protocol), the remote socket features encoder pulses of the Focus and Zoom motor for i.e., VR applications.

Checking for current software version
On start-up after powering, the software version is displayed for about 3 seconds by a combination of the two top-side LED bars (5x blue ones from zoom speed indicator and three yellow ones of the servo switch states of F/I/Z motor). Both bars form a binary encoded value where the blue LEDs stand for the most significant and the three yellow ones for the least significant part of the number separated by an imaginary dot.

Software update via USB
Chrosziel is continuously improving the software of the system based on the demands of the industry including customer-requested improvements. The user can easily install an update to the latest software. The only requested items are the software files supplied by Chrosziel and a standard USB- Stick. Contact your dealer or Chrosziel directly to obtain new files or get registered for the respective newsletter. To register for update notifications, please draft an e-mail to sales@chrosziel.com . Include product serial number, name, company, and email address. We comply with all statutory data protection laws.

Copy the two provided software files into the root of a USB stick (FAT/FAT32 formatted). Make sure to copy both files (“pmimg_m.hex” and “pmimg_s.hex”)!

Update procedure

  • Power drive down
  • Remove the dust cover from the USB socket and plug the USB stick with software files into it.
  • Press and hold down buttons “Iris Servo” and “Focus Servo” on the top side of the drive and repower it. The unit will perform the update indicating the progress by different LED flashing patterns. After the update, the unit restarts automatically displaying the current software version with the top-side LED stripes for 3 seconds and performing the automated lens calibration.
